How to fill out an inter-agency referral to children's services:

01
Begin by obtaining the necessary referral form from your local children's services department or agency. This form will typically request important information about the child in question, their family, and the reason for the referral.
02
Start by filling out the child's personal information section, including their full name, date of birth, address, and contact details. Ensure that all information provided is accurate and up to date.
03
Provide relevant details about the child's family, such as the names and contact information of their parents or guardians. It is crucial to include any additional caregivers or relatives who play a significant role in the child's life.
04
In the referral form, describe the specific concerns or reasons for seeking inter-agency involvement. This could include matters related to the child's well-being, safety, educational needs, or potential developmental delays.
05
If applicable, provide any information about previous assessments, interventions, or services that have already been provided to the child and their family. Including this information can help agencies understand the child's history and the effectiveness of past interventions.
06
Consider attaching any supporting documentation, such as medical records, academic reports, or behavior observations, which can further support the referral and provide a comprehensive understanding of the child's needs.
07
Once all the necessary sections of the referral form are completed, review the information thoroughly to ensure accuracy and clarity. Correct any errors or omissions before submitting the form.
08
Finally, submit the inter-agency referral form to the designated contact person or department. It is essential to follow any specific submission procedures or guidelines provided by the agency.
09
Remember that the process may vary depending on your location and the specific agency's requirements, so it is advisable to reach out to the children's services department for any additional guidance or clarification.

Who needs an inter-agency referral to children's services?

01
Parents or guardians of a child who requires additional support or intervention due to developmental, educational, behavioral, or safety concerns.
02
Teachers, school administrators, or daycare providers who have identified issues affecting a child's overall well-being or academic progress.
03
Healthcare professionals who identify medical, psychological, or social factors potentially impacting a child's development or overall functioning.
04
Social workers or other professionals working with families who require additional support or intervention to address complex or challenging situations.
05
Any individual who suspects that a child may be experiencing neglect, abuse, or unsafe living conditions and believes that children's services should intervene to ensure their safety and well-being.
